.When clams bank on living with a killer, often their good fortune may run out, depending on to an University of Michigan study.A historical inquiry in ecology talks to how may a lot of different varieties co-occur, or even cohabit, at the same time and at the same location. One influential idea phoned the competitive exclusion concept suggests that only one types can take up a particular specific niche in an organic community at any sort of one time.However out in bush, analysts locate lots of circumstances of different varieties that appear to occupy the exact same niches at the same time, living in the same microhabitats as well as taking in the same meals.U-M ecology and also evolutionary the field of biology graduate student Teal Harrison and her adviser Diarmaid u00d3 Foighil took a look at one such instance: a highly focused neighborhood of 7 aquatic clam types residing in the retreats of their bunch species, an aggressive mantis shrimp.Six of these seven clam varieties, named yoyo clams, attach to the shrimp's burrow wall structures with a lengthy foot utilized to spring season, yoyo-like, away from risk. The 7th of the clam varieties, a near loved one of the yoyo clams, possesses an unique within-burrow niche market during that it attaches straight to the lot mantis shrimp's body as well as does not yoyo. The scientists asked yourself exactly how this unusual clam neighborhood continues to persist." Our company have actually got this remarkable scenario where all these clam varieties certainly not simply share the exact same hold but many of all of them have also developed, or even speciated, on that particular host. How is this feasible?" pointed out u00d3 Foighil, additionally a conservator of mollusks at the U-M Museum of Zoology.When Harrison carried out area examples of these clam varieties in mantis shrimp retreats, what she found went against academic requirements: all retreats that contained various species of clams were actually comprised entirely of the shelter wall structure yoyo clams. And also when the host-attached clam types was included in the mix in a research laboratory experiment, the mantis shrimp killed every one of the burrow-wall clams.This violates academic desire, the analysts say. According to the affordable exclusion guideline, types that progress to reside in various particular niches need to live together a lot more often than varieties that take up the very same niche. Yet Harrison's records, posted in the publication PeerJ, propose that the progression of a brand-new, host-attached specific niche has paradoxically resulted in ecological exemption, not cohabitation, amongst these commensal clams." Teal had two collections of unanticipated outcomes. Some of them was that the species that must co-occur along with the yoyo clams doesn't. And the second unexpected result was that the host can go fake," u00d3 Foighil mentioned. "The exciting twist is the only survivor was a clam attached to the mantis shrimp's physical body. Just about anything on the den wall structure, it got rid of. It even went outside the den and also killed one that had wandered out.".The reasonable exclusion principle anticipates that the six yoyo clam varieties (which discuss the burrow-wall specific niche) are going to co-occupy lot burrows much less regularly with one another than with the (niche-differentiated) host-attached clam types. Harrison tested this prophecy by field-censusing populations in the Indian River Lagoon, Florida. This engaged very carefully catching multitude mantis shrimp through palm and tasting their shelters for clams making use of a stainless-steel lure pump.Harrison at that point built artificial dens busy where she might examine, up close, commensal clam behavior with as well as without a mantis shrimp bunch. "When you get a fully unanticipated cause science, it is actually possibly telling you one thing brand new as well as significant.".The scientists claim that the exemption system-- shutting out burrow-wall and host-attached clam co-occurrence-- is presently confusing. One reason could be that, during the course of the larval stage, lair wall clams sponsor to different range dens than the host-attached clams. Yet it additionally could be differential survival in shelter assemblages that possess both burrow wall surface and host-attached clams-- that is actually, likely that mixed populace of clams activates a fatal response in the host, u00d3 Foighil said.The analysts' following actions are actually to look into what took place. It can possess been an artifact of the setup in the laboratory, u00d3 Foighil mentioned. Or even maybe informing the scientists that under some ailments, the commensal association of the den wall surface yoyo clams and also the predatory multitude may "break catastrophically," he mentioned." It was actually fairly cool to possess a looking for that was contrary to what we were assuming based upon transformative concept, and it was actually certainly not simply in contrast to our academic assumptions, yet it took place in such a significant technique," Harrison pointed out.The analysts have popped the question two follow-up research studies. The first to calculate if each types of commensals may employ as larvae to the exact same host burrows. The 2nd to assess whether the mantis shrimp itself is the offender: performs its predatory actions change when the host-attached types is contributed to its den?Study co-authors consist of Ryutaro Goto of Kyoto Educational institution, that triggered this profession as a postdoctoral analyst in u00d3 Foighil's laboratory, as well as Jingchun Li of the College of Colorado, likewise a previous college student in the u00d3 Foighil laboratory.
